1. Q: What is AWS CloudFormation?


A: AWS CloudFormation is a service that allows you to provision and manage AWS
resources using declarative templates. It enables you to define your infrastructure
as code.

2. Q: How do you create an EC2 instance using AWS CLI?


A: You can use the `aws ec2 run-instances` command to create an EC2 instance. For
example:

```bash
aws ec2 run-instances --image-id ami-12345678 --instance-type t2.micro --key-name
my-keypair --security-group-ids sg-12345678 --subnet-id subnet-12345678
```

3. Q: What is an Auto Scaling group in AWS?


A: An Auto Scaling group is a group of EC2 instances that are automatically scaled
up or down based on defined conditions. It helps ensure application availability
and allows for efficient resource utilization.

4. Q: How do you create an S3 bucket using AWS CLI?


A: You can use the `aws s3api create-bucket` command to create an S3 bucket. For
example:

```bash
aws s3api create-bucket --bucket my-bucket --region us-west-2
```

5. Q: What is AWS Lambda?


A: AWS Lambda is a serverless compute service that allows you to run your code
without provisioning or managing servers. It automatically scales your applications
in response to incoming requests.

6. Q: How do you create an AWS Lambda function using AWS CLI?


A: You can use the `aws lambda create-function` command to create an AWS Lambda
function. For example:

```bash
aws lambda create-function --function-name my-function --runtime python3.8 --
handler index.handler --role arn:aws:iam::123456789012:role/my-role --zip-file
fileb://my-function.zip
```

7. Q: What is Amazon ECS (Elastic Container Service)?


A: Amazon ECS is a fully managed container orchestration service that allows you to
run and scale containerized applications using Docker containers.

8. Q: How do you create an Amazon ECS cluster using AWS CLI?


A: You can use the `aws ecs create-cluster` command to create an Amazon ECS
cluster. For example:

```bash
aws ecs create-cluster --cluster-name my-cluster
```
9. Q: What is AWS Elastic Beanstalk?
A: AWS Elastic Beanstalk is a fully managed service that makes it easy to deploy,
run, and scale web applications. It abstracts the underlying infrastructure and
handles the deployment details for you.

10. Q: How do you deploy an application to AWS Elastic Beanstalk using AWS CLI?
A: You can use the `eb deploy` command to deploy an application to AWS Elastic
Beanstalk. For example:

```bash
eb deploy my-application-environment
```

11. Q: What is Amazon RDS (Relational Database Service)?


A: Amazon RDS is a managed database service that simplifies the setup, operation,
and scaling of relational databases such as MySQL, PostgreSQL, Oracle, and SQL
Server.

12. Q: How do you create an Amazon RDS instance using AWS CLI?
A: You can use the `aws rds create-db-instance` command to create an Amazon RDS
instance. For example:

```bash
aws rds create-db-instance --db-instance-identifier my-instance --engine mysql --
master-username admin --master-user-password mypassword --allocated-storage 20 --
db-instance-class db

.t2.micro
```

13. Q: What is AWS CodeDeploy?


A: AWS CodeDeploy is a fully managed deployment service that automates application
deployments to EC2 instances, Lambda functions, or on-premises instances.

14. Q: How do you create an AWS CodeDeploy application using AWS CLI?
A: You can use the `aws deploy create-application` command to create an AWS
CodeDeploy application. For example:

```bash
aws deploy create-application --application-name my-application
```

15. Q: What is AWS CloudWatch?


A: AWS CloudWatch is a monitoring and observability service that provides metrics,
logs, and events about your AWS resources and applications.

16. Q: How do you create a CloudWatch alarm using AWS CLI?


A: You can use the `aws cloudwatch put-metric-alarm` command to create a CloudWatch
alarm. For example:

```bash
aws cloudwatch put-metric-alarm --alarm-name my-alarm --comparison-operator
GreaterThanOrEqualToThreshold --evaluation-periods 1 --metric-name CPUUtilization
--namespace AWS/EC2 --period 60 --statistic Average --threshold 80 --alarm-actions
arn:aws:sns:us-west-2:123456789012:my-topic
```

17. Q: What is AWS Identity and Access Management (IAM)?


A: AWS IAM is a service that enables you to securely control access to AWS
resources. It allows you to create and manage users, groups, and permissions.

18. Q: How do you create an IAM user using AWS CLI?


A: You can use the `aws iam create-user` command to create an IAM user. For
example:

```bash
aws iam create-user --user-name my-user
```

19. Q: What is AWS CloudTrail?


A: AWS CloudTrail is a service that enables governance, compliance, operational
auditing, and risk auditing of your AWS account. It provides a history of AWS API
calls for your account.

20. Q: How do you enable AWS CloudTrail for an AWS account using AWS CLI?
A: You can use the `aws cloudtrail create-trail` command to enable AWS CloudTrail.
For example:

```bash
aws cloudtrail create-trail --name my-trail --s3-bucket-name my-bucket --is-multi-
region-trail
```

21. Q: What is AWS SNS (Simple Notification Service)?


A: AWS SNS is a fully managed pub/sub messaging service that enables you to send
notifications and messages to subscribers.

22. Q: How do you create an SNS topic using AWS CLI?


A: You can use the `aws sns create-topic` command to create an SNS topic. For
example:

```bash
aws sns create-topic --name my-topic
```

23. Q: What is AWS CloudFront?


A: AWS CloudFront is a content delivery network (CDN) service that accelerates the
delivery of your websites, APIs, video content, and other web assets.

24. Q: How do you create an AWS CloudFront distribution using AWS CLI?
A: You can use the `aws cloudfront create-distribution` command to create an AWS
CloudFront distribution. For example:

```bash
aws cloudfront create-distribution --origin-domain-name example.com --default-root-
object index.html
```

25. Q: What is AWS Route 53?


A: AWS Route 53 is a scalable domain name system (DNS) web service that provides
reliable and cost-effective domain registration, DNS routing, and health checking.

26. Q

: How do you create a DNS record in AWS Route 53 using AWS CLI?
A: You can use the `aws route53 change-resource-record-sets` command to create a
DNS record in AWS Route 53. For example:
```bash
aws route53 change-resource-record-sets --hosted-zone-id Z1234567890 --change-batch
file://change-batch.json
```

27. Q: What is AWS CloudWatch Logs?


A: AWS CloudWatch Logs is a fully managed service for real-time monitoring and
troubleshooting of your log files from EC2 instances, AWS Lambda functions, and
other sources.

28. Q: How do you create a log group in AWS CloudWatch Logs using AWS CLI?
A: You can use the `aws logs create-log-group` command to create a log group in AWS
CloudWatch Logs. For example:

```bash
aws logs create-log-group --log-group-name my-log-group
```

29. Q: What is AWS Elastic Load Balancer (ELB)?


A: AWS Elastic Load Balancer (ELB) is a service that automatically distributes
incoming application traffic across multiple targets, such as EC2 instances or
containers.

30. Q: How do you create an AWS Elastic Load Balancer using AWS CLI?
A: You can use the `aws elbv2 create-load-balancer` command to create an AWS
Elastic Load Balancer. For example:

```bash
aws elbv2 create-load-balancer --name my-load-balancer --subnets subnet-12345678 --
security-groups sg-12345678 --type application
```
